Mara's Crazy Feta Chicken Salad
Creamy Feta Chicken Salad
Cool, herb-heavy chicken salad with cucumber, tomato, mint, dill, and a whipped lemon-feta dressing. This is a Regular Foods / after recovery recipe because the raw cucumber, tomato skins, onion, and fresh herbs can be fibrous or difficult to tolerate. Use it only after your care team has cleared comparable raw vegetables. Chop everything finely, take small bites, chew thoroughly, and stop at comfortable fullness. Feta and canned chicken can make the sodium high; compare labels or choose lower-sodium products when needed. Contains milk.

Ingredients
- 6 ounces canned chicken breast, drained
- 1/2 cup chopped tomatoes
- 1 cup finely chopped Persian cucumber
- 2 tablespoons finely diced red onion
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h dill
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h mint
- 1/2 cup plain nonfat Greek yogurt
- 2 ounces low-fat feta cheese
- 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
- 1 garlic clove, minced
- 1 to 2 tablespoons water, as needed
- Ground black pepper, to taste
- Small pinch kosher salt, optional
Directions
- 1
Add the Greek yogurt, feta, lemon juice, garlic, black pepper, and 1 tablespoon water to a blender or food processor. Blend until smooth and spoonable, adding the second tablespoon of water only if needed.
- 2
In a mixing bowl, combine the drained chicken, tomato, cucumber, red onion, dill, and mint. Break the chicken into small, easy-to-chew pieces.
- 3
Fold in the feta dressing until the chicken and vegetables are evenly coated. Taste before adding the optional salt because the chicken and feta may already provide enough sodium.
- 4
Cover and refrigerate for at least 20 minutes so the flavors can settle. Keep at 40°F / 4°C or colder.
- 5
Measure the finished salad and divide it into three equal portions, approximately 1 cup each. If the actual yield differs, use one-third of the batch as the reference serving rather than overfilling a container.
- 6
Refrigerate leftovers promptly in a covered container and use within 3 to 4 days. Do not leave the salad at room temperature for more than 2 hours, or more than 1 hour when the temperature is above 90°F / 32°C.
